Dragonland is a symphonic power metal musical group from Sweden. The group is most notable for basing their two first albums upon the self-produced The Dragonland Chronicles fantasy saga and for the original symphonic/electronic parts by Elias Holmlid. Nightrage's Marios Iliopoulos and Jimmie Strimell have provided guest appearances on their latest album, Astronomy.
